Band History:
Jacqueline Ryks/Melini
Age: 37
I have been singing since I can remember. My mom sang professionally for a while, and I vaguely remember her singing in the studio in Danbury, Ct. So I was hooked when I heard her. And I knew from then I wanted to sing and write music. I was born in Danbury, Ct., when I was about 5 we moved to Southern Illinois. We first moved to Energy, Il. and we attended a small but wonderful Methodist Church were I sang in the Choir I loved it. Then to Herrin, then Carterville, then our last stop was Crainville, Il. Where I attended Carterville Community High School. Then we moved to Ebensburg, Pa., where I attended Central Cambria High School. I have been writing lyrics, poems and music since I was about 15 or 16. Then we moved to Millville, N.J. when I was 21 and I met a great musician by the name of Walt Sapsai.
This CD is the 2nd one for myself and my husband Joe. I moved to New Jersey in 1988. I met Walt in 1989, and we jammed while he was in working bands and have remained best of friends ever since. I met my husband Joe in 1995 and found out he was a musician too. Well I fell in love. WE married and have been making beautiful rock music ever since.
My favorite singers/bands are:
Stevie Nicks/Fleetwood Mac, Heart-Ann Wilson, Pat Benatar,Wynona Judd, Rainbow, Deep Purple,Twisted Sister Dio, Krokus, any 80's heavy metal bands. Lynyrd Skynyrd, Blackfoot, Rossington/Collins Band-Dale Krantz-Rossington I love all Southern Rock tunes.
I just love writing and recording.
